Project Indiana Summary:
Proposed Location: Collective 25 acres +/- of A-2 zoned properties at 6700 Indiana Street, 6702 Indiana Street, 6710 Indiana Street and a portion of 6720 Indiana Street in unicorporated Jefferson County.
7.96 acres of light industrial in Arvada
Proposed site is app. 36 total acres adjacent to Ralston Creek and Maple Valley Park Open Space
Distribution Center will be 112,000+ sf (approximately 552’ N/S elevation x 203’ E/W elevation x 44’ in height)
Over 1500 total vehicle / van / semi-truck parking spaces
402 associate parking spaces accessed for 2-3 shifts daily
983 van parking spaces accessed several times daily for two shifts
60 van loading spaces, 60 van staging spaces
12-15 semi-truck parking spaces
21 truck docks with up to 42 semi-truck trips every night of the week
Semi trucks load on east and vans load on north facing park and homes
Access is expected to come directly off Indiana St, West 67th Ave, Fig Street, West 66th Place, and Holman Street
Estimated traffic expected to be 3,000-5,000 vehicles in and out daily
Community Concerns:
Excessive light and noise pollution 24 hours a day, 7 days a week
Drastic increase in traffic on Indiana St and surrounding neighborhoods
Negative impact on quality of life, homes and property values
Insufficient buffer between the industrial use and open space/homes
Removal of hundreds of large, old growth trees
Negative impacts on wildlife in open space and riparian life in creek
Negative impact to Ralston Creek from development storm drainage
Does not reflect the character and culture of the surrounding community
Future proposed drone operations will negatively affect wildlife and residents in the area
